Transaction 74bab1a99e5838a10ec8f40f29f92fd41f7a948248e293dc2007ddda177297fe
1 Input
1 Output
-
74bab1a99e5838a10ec8f40f29f92fd41f7a948248e293dc2007ddda177297fe:0
- value
- 1482925
- script pubkey
- OP_0 OP_PUSHBYTES_20 8671d4b37ac14ae740e06a55a699d6bbc0d93aca
- address
- bc1qsecafvm6c99wws8qdf26dxwkh0qdjwk2hak7y2